在tomcat7 maven插件中设置ENV变量

Posted

技术标签:

【中文标题】在tomcat7 maven插件中设置ENV变量【英文标题】:Set ENV variables in tomcat7 maven plugin 【发布时间】:2015-05-19 20:23:12 【问题描述】:

有没有办法通过tomcat7-maven-plugin 设置ENV 变量,使它们出现在System.getenv() 中?

可以使用出现在System.getProperties() 映射中的<systemProperties> 设置系统属性。我正在寻找一种类似的方式来传递环境变量。

【问题讨论】:

你在哪里能弄明白? 【参考方案1】:

这里已经回答了这个问题:Setting User Environment Variables for tomcat on Windows

从管理员命令提示符执行以下命令:

tomcat8 //US//YourServiceName ++Environment varname=value

您可以设置多个变量,用分号分隔它们 (;) 或哈希 (#)。

【讨论】:

在构建过程中运行 Tomcat Maven 插件时,这将无助于设置环境变量

以上是关于在tomcat7 maven插件中设置ENV变量的主要内容,如果未能解决你的问题,请参考以下文章

如何在 Jupyter notebook 中设置环境变量

如何在 Maven 发布插件中设置 SCM 标签?

在 Maven 2 的命令行中设置插件的版本

在 Maven 中设置环境变量

如何在 Gitlab CI 中设置环境变量并使其在本地可测试

在Gatsby中设置环境变量